Quick Answer

Arapahoe County, CO: 0.56% effective rate · $4,031/yr median tax · median home $719,879

Hendricks County, IN: 0.67% effective rate · $1,332/yr median tax · median home $198,869

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the property tax difference between Arapahoe County and Hendricks County?
Arapahoe County, CO has an effective property tax rate of 0.56% with a median annual tax of $4,031. Hendricks County, IN has a rate of 0.67% with a median annual tax of $1,332. The difference is 0.11 percentage points.
Which county has higher property taxes, Arapahoe County or Hendricks County?
Hendricks County, IN has the higher effective property tax rate at 0.67% compared to 0.56%.
How do Arapahoe County and Hendricks County compare to the national average?
The national average effective property tax rate is 1.06%. Arapahoe County is below average at 0.56%, and Hendricks County is below average at 0.67%.
